Video shows man pouring gasoline, setting fire inside Huntington Place

Authorities searching for suspect

DETROIT – Authorities are searching for a man who poured gasoline and lit a fire inside Huntington Place.

Detroit fire investigators said a man was caught on camera going inside Huntington Place on April 28 just before 9 a.m., dousing the carpet with gasoline, walking toward the exit and setting a fire before leaving.

Investigators are searching for a man wearing all black, with a black backpack with several white logos on it, and a grey mask on his face. He allegedly set a fire inside Huntington Place on April 28. (Detroit Police Department)
Investigators are searching for a man wearing all black, with a black backpack with several white logos on it, and a grey mask on his face. He allegedly set a fire inside Huntington Place on April 28. (Detroit Police Department)

The fire was immediately extinguished and caused minimal damage. No one was hurt.

Investigators said a reward will be offered if information leads to an arrest.
